LAUNCH OF SARS SIYAKHA TRANSFORMATION PROGRAMME IN THE WESTERN CAPE

The Executive Committee of the South African Revenue Service (SARS) is pleased to announce the implementation of the Siyakha Transformation Programme in the Western Cape.

The initial phase of implementation will focus on consolidating the Cape Town and Bellville offices. This will result in the creation of an Assessment Centre to be housed at Sable Building, an Enforcement Centre at Project 166, a Call Centre at Project 166 and new branch offices.

These changes will lead to a concentration of resources and capabilities in order to improve the quality of service to the public. The Assessment Centre will focus on improving the quality of assessments and on reducing the turn-around times in processing of taxpayer returns. The Enforcement Centre will sharpen our focus on improving the prevailing compliance climate, with emphasis on reducing the tax gap and on raising the levels of voluntary compliance. In keeping with our overall efforts to better our service levels, the branch offices and the call centre will focus on high resolution levels of taxpayer and trader queries. The SARS Service Monitoring Office, launched last week, will monitor the service to the public to ensure that taxpayer and trade queries on procedural matters are resolved satisfactorily.
